Cattany <br />Safeco Plaza <br />Seattle, WA 98185 Division Director <br />Natural Resource Trustee <br />Re: Seneca II Mine (Permit No. C-1980-005) <br />Bond Release Application No. 3 (SL-3) <br />Bond No. <br />Dear Sir or Madam: <br />This letter, as required by Rule 3.03.2(5)(a) of the Rules and Regulations, is to inform you that the <br />Division of Reclamation, Mining and Safety has issued a proposed decision to Approve Bond Release <br />Application No. 3 for the Seneca II Mine. This decision will be published in the Steamboat Pilot as <br />soon as possible. Publication of the notice initiates a thirty (30) day public comment period. If, within <br />thirty days, there are no requests for an adjudicatory hearing, the decision will become final. <br />One of several bonds for the operation is a Corporate Surety issued by your company (Bond No. <br /> , in the amount of $1,355,000.00. The total proposed release amount for SU is <br />$1,975,695.00. <br />Please be aware that this notification is not a request to initiate any action by Safeco Insurance <br />Company of America concerning Bond No. and is for your information only.
